​Tottenham tempted to cut Janssen's Fenerbahce loan short

Tottenham are contemplating recalling striker Vincent Janssen from his loan spell at Fenerbahce during the January transfer window.

Janssen went to Fenerbahce at the end of the summer transfer window, following his inability to convince manager Mauricio Pochettino that he could compete with the likes of Harry Kane and Hueng-Min Son for a position the first team.

However, Janssen has only scored twice during his loan spell, despite being a favourite with the Fener fans.

The reasons for Spurs recalling Janssen are unclear. Some reports suggest he will take Fernando Llorente's position in the squad, while others suggest he will be sold to Napoli.
